7+ Easy Steps: How to Rebuild a Spider Fuel Injector (DIY)

The process involves disassembling, cleaning, and replacing worn components within a specific type of fuel delivery system found in some General Motors vehicles. This system, often referred to by its distinct configuration, uses a central body with multiple fuel lines extending to individual poppet valves at each cylinder. Rebuilding entails careful removal of seals, filters, and potentially the poppet valves themselves, followed by meticulous cleaning and the installation of new parts.

Proper maintenance of this fuel delivery mechanism can restore optimal engine performance, improve fuel economy, and prevent costly repairs down the line. Originally implemented as a cost-effective alternative to multi-port fuel injection, understanding its nuances is crucial for mechanics and vehicle owners working on these older models. Restoring its functionality can also preserve the original design and operational characteristics of these vehicles.

7+ Easy Quadrajet How to Rebuild: Guide & Tips

The process concerns the restoration of a specific type of carburetor, originally manufactured by Rochester, to a functional or improved state. This involves disassembling the unit, cleaning each component, replacing worn or damaged parts, and then reassembling and adjusting the carburetor to achieve optimal performance. The procedures can range from simple cleaning and adjustment to complete overhaul with new components.

Proper carburetor maintenance ensures efficient engine operation, improved fuel economy, and reduced emissions. A restored unit can offer reliable performance comparable to a new carburetor, often at a lower cost. Furthermore, restoring these carburetors preserves the functionality of classic vehicles and maintains their original specifications. Its development history is intertwined with the automotive industry’s move towards greater fuel efficiency and performance during the late 20th century.
